## Ownership

Undo and redo in the Sketchforge diagram editor are implemented through the command-stack module, which records inverse operations for every canvas mutation. Changes here are high-risk: a faulty inverse can silently corrupt user documents. Any modification must include replay tests against the archived scenario corpus before release. Questions about stack depth limits, merge behavior, or serialization belong to the owner listed below.

named custodian: Zorok Briir Novvan

Runbook: Driftgate WS tier. permessage-deflate stays OFF for the broadcast fanout — CPU cost on the edge pods outweighs bandwidth savings above 4k concurrent sockets. Enable it only on the admin channel, where payloads are large and connections few. If compression ratio drops below 1.3 in the Harbinger dashboard, revert. Toggle lives in the Veldspar config service; changes require a staged rollout. To flip the flag, authenticate against Veldspar with the key below.

app token of badug-tahaf = qvz11-nP5FBNr8qnh

Subject: Cut-over summary — Renderhive transcoding farm

Team, the migration from the old Brackenpool nodes to the new Renderhive pool completed overnight. Queue depth stayed under threshold, and no jobs were dropped during the drain. Two encoder presets were normalized during the move, so please review the diffs carefully before we retire the old pool. For reference, the post-cut-over configuration now in effect is listed below.

deployment values, yadug-bawif:
[framir]
team = pelox
access_code = ac_a38ab2
owner = tamion.julael
host = framir.tolvaqlabs.test
port = 11211
peer = tammir.zemvargrid.local
salt = 2215ef03
pin = 1541